Abstract
The utility model belongs to printed wiring board technical field, disclose a kind of pcb board secondary operation equipment, the first rotational supporting block and the second rotational supporting block including tool substrate and for support jig substrate, set respectively in the tool substrate mobilizable for fixing the preceding fixture block of pcb board and rear fixture block, the preceding fixture block and the rear fixture block are connected by the fixture block gib block for being arranged on the tool substrate both sides and being connected by screw with the tool substrate, it is particularly applicable to high-precision fixing circuit board, be fixed in tool substrate can be with tool substrate activity for pcb board in practical operation, it can overturn or be rotated by 90 ° in axis direction so as to realize, 180 °, 270 °, 360 °, facilitate the multiaspect technological operation of circuit board, realize circuit board on-line operation.

Embodiment
With reference to shown in figure 1, a kind of pcb board secondary operation equipment, including tool substrate 18, the first rotational supporting block 13,
Two rotational supporting blocks 20, rotational positioning block 11, one end of the tool substrate 18 are connected with the second rotational supporting block 20, and for that can live
Dynamic connection, i.e. tool substrate 18 can surround the tie point rotary moveable of tool substrate and the second rotational supporting block 20, tool base
The other end of plate 18 can surround through the first rotational supporting block 13 and the 11 movable connection of rotational positioning block, i.e. tool substrate 18
Tool substrate 18 and the tie point rotary moveable of rotational positioning block 11, and tool base can be fixed or locked to rotational positioning block 11
The anglec of rotation of plate 18, in the present embodiment, the second rotational supporting block 20 are connected dot center and tool substrate with tool substrate 18
18 run through the axle center of the first rotational supporting block 13, rotational positioning block 11 with the tie point central point of tool substrate 18 in same level axle
On heart line.
In the present embodiment, pcb board rest area 16 is set, and the left end of pcb board rest area 16 is set can in the tool substrate
The preceding fixture block 17 of activity, the right-hand member of pcb board rest area set mobilizable rear fixture block 15, and the preceding fixture block 17 and rear fixture block 15 are main
For fixed placement in the position of the pcb board of pcb board rest area 16, and the position of the preceding fixture block 17 and rear fixture block 15 is by setting
Put in tool substrate 18 and with fixture block gib block 14 that tool substrate 18 is connected by screw being connected, it is necessary to explanation
It is that, according to the process requirements of actual pcb board, the pcb board rest area of the tool substrate in the present embodiment can be and tool substrate
Integrative-structure, a hollow region of tool substrate can also be penetrated, can so facilitate the multiaspect process requirements of pcb board, saved
Save process time.
In the present embodiment, rotating card block is set between first rotational supporting block 20 and the rotational positioning block 11
12, the tool substrate 18 runs through the rotating card block 12, and the setting of the rotating card block 12 can assist rotational positioning block 11 to enter
One step secures the anglec of rotation of tool substrate.
In the present embodiment, in addition to bonding wire clamping device 19, bonding wire clamping device 19 in the tool substrate by setting
The neck put is connected with the tool substrate, and the bonding wire clamping device 19 can be along neck activity.
In the present embodiment, the first rotational supporting block 20, the second rotational supporting block 13 and rotational positioning block 11 are trapezoidal
Structure, and the top of trapezium structure is circular shape, can effectively prevent operating personnel's accidental injury or gouge.
